Article description: (description ) This attribute controls the content of the description and og:description elements. | Witchcraft is an urban fantasy game set in a world like our own, but with an extensive Masquerade to mask the fact that just about every supernatural being and mythological figure exists (or has existed). The players take the part of the Gifted - humans who secretly wield the power of magic, psychic abilities, divine miracles, or other supernatural traits. For all of recorded history, the Gifted have kept their existence a secret, but now the world is threatened by an approaching Reckoning, and new Gifted are being born in record numbers. The time for hiding in the shadows is coming to an end... |
